Biological activities of Punica granatum L. and the emerging role of metabolomics in enhancing its therapeutic potential: A narrative review

Meharunnisa, Fatima Rafique
Pomegranate has long been used in Greco-Arab medicine for gastrointestinal, cardiovascular, metabolic, and inflammatory disorders. It has been described to relieve nausea, vomiting, abdominal pain, diarrhoea, palpitations, etc. Modern scientific studies have validated these uses, attributing them to a rich phytochemical profile of polyphenols, flavonoids, anthocyanins, tannins, punicalagins, and ellagitannins. However, the precise mechanism of action and optimal application strategies for pomegranate in systemic diseases remain an area of investigation. Metabolomics provides a robust platform for elucidating the intricate relationships between pomegranate bioactives and human physiology. Therefore, to evaluate the therapeutic potential of pomegranate (Punica granatum L.) and find out how metabolomics can enhance its pharmacological applications, a literature review was conducted using ancient & modern pharmacology books, PubMed, Scopus, Web of Science, and Google Scholar. Human clinical trials were prioritized, followed by in vivo and in vitro studies. Evidence was synthesized qualitatively with emphasis on metabolomic findings. The research question was framed to determine whether metabolomics can enhance and optimize the therapeutic potential of pomegranate. Metabolomic studies demonstrated that pomegranate exhibits all its biological activities through gut microbiota-derived metabolites, particularly urolithins, which play a key role in mediating these effects. Therefore, it was concluded that integration of metabolomics with traditional pharmacology can enhance pomegranate-based therapeutics and support its role in precision nutrition.
